A geometric sans with rounded-rectangle construction and consistently softened corners. Strokes are even and solid, with wide, extended proportions and generous horizontal spans. Counters in letters like O, D, P, and e are superelliptical and tightly controlled, while terminals tend to be squared-off with radiused ends. The rhythm is compact and engineered: short apertures, flattened curves, and a strong baseline presence produce a clean, modular texture in text. Numerals follow the same rounded-rect logic, keeping a unified, system-like feel.

Diagonal-heavy forms (V, W, X, Y, Z) are crisp and angular, contrasting with the softened bowls elsewhere. The lowercase keeps a simple, modern structure with single-storey a and g, and a compact, closed e that reinforces the font’s streamlined, techno texture.
